Recognizing That God Is at Work

The humble will see their God at work and be glad.

Let all who seek God’s help be encouraged.

For the LORD hears the cries of the needy;

he does not despise his imprisoned people.

Praise him, O heaven and earth,

the seas and all that move in them.

Psalm 69:32-34

Sometimes when we are in our deepest depression, we despair of anyone hearing our cries for help. David felt this way. His enemies had surrounded him and were even gloating over him. Yet toward the end of this prayer, David reminded himself that God does hear “the cries of the needy.” He does work out his good plan for his people. One day, the humble will rejoice in the Lord’s work. David knew the Lord heard his cries and would answer him. In this he could rejoice.

Sometime you may find your joy being sapped away by a difficult situation. Remind yourself of God’s ability to hear your cry for help. Look for ways God is already working in your church and in your community. “The humble will see their God at work and be glad.”
